Rye has been a staple grain for millennia—sought after for its stubborn resilience in the field and revered for its unique flavor. Ruthless Rye IPA is brewed with rustic grains for refined flavors, combining the peppery spice of rye and the bright citrusy flavors of whole-cone hops to create a complex ale for the tumultuous transition to spring.

Bottle, at Nærbø Ølfestival 2013. An almost clear one, golden in color and with a small, light beige head. The aroma is fruity, with some pine cones and peaches, and a maltyness. A bit low on the bitterness in the flavor, a faint peppery note showing up. Fruity and lightly malty. Full bodied and with a pleasant carbonation. Lasting bitter finish. A nice one indeed, but I would like more rye impact and bitterness. 131019

Sampled at Nærbø Ølfestival 2013. Clear golden body with an off-white head. Pleasant fruity aroma with some pine and soft malt. Flavor sweet malty, citric fruity, pine and good balanced bitterness. Medium body and fine aftertaste with sweet malt and fruity bitterness. Smooth and balanced IPA.

Bottle, 2013 vintage. Pours hazy dark orange with an airy finger thick head. Aroma is hoppy orange and apricot, as well as grainy malt, caramel, some spices and a whiff of alcohol. Creamy body with soft carbonation. Flavour is bitter with hoppy orange peel, grapefruit, apricot and toffee.
